Transaction 6491f26133d77fddcf73545d2148c43777b73809d35e6867db2dbf498e0df130

3 Input
1 Outputs
  • 6491f26133d77fddcf73545d2148c43777b73809d35e6867db2dbf498e0df130:0
  • value  5281433
    address  3FyigVCysWwn5S6ni2nXA1dGtNz8vbrDti